> > Second question: How can I have model instances from different
> > connections?
>
> You can have model classes with separate database connections:
>
> class ModelA < Sequel::Model(DB1[:table1])
> end
>
> class ModelB < Sequel::Model(DB2[:table2])
> end
>

This is what I wanted to avoid.


> The Sequel::Model method takes any dataset, so it's easy to specify
> that the model class should use a specific database by giving it a
> dataset from that database.
>
> If you meant how to get two model instances from the same class to
> connect to different Database objects, you can't.

> > Two entry points for specifying connection are sufficient for me: one
> > factory method (that creates model instances) and method for selecting
> > objects (find).
>
> > Something like:
> > schedule = ETLJobSchedule.new_from_connection(@connection)
> > schedules = ETLJobSchedule.find_using_connection(@connection, ...)
>
> That's not how Sequel works.  You don't deal with connection objects,
> and while Sequel does make them available if you need them for low
> level stuff, there's no Sequel methods that accept them as arguments.
> You can do something like:
>
>   schedules = ETLJobSchedule.server(:shard_id).first(...)
>
> To retrieve schedules from a specific shard.
>
> However, the new_from_connection can't be duplicated without some
> small extensions.  Currently you'd need to override Model#_insert
> (kind of large), but I'd be OK with refactoring so that you'd only
> need to override a new method like _insert_dataset.  For updating and
> deleting records, you would have to override _update_dataset and
> _delete_dataset.  The only issue there is that Sequel does not store
> which shard was used to retrieve the objects.  For that you could use
> the tactical_eager_loading plugin, and call retrieved_by to get access
> to the dataset that was used to retrieve the object, and get the shard
> id to use in _update_dataset and _delete_dataset.
